The challenge

Vintage camera buyers need to assess mechanical condition, lens clarity, and cosmetic wear. Photos must show functionality indicators clearly.

selling photo requirements

  • All angles including top and bottom
  • Lens elements clearly visible
  • Mechanical components shown
  • Any wear or damage documented

Vintage cameras photography challenges

  • Showing lens element condition
  • Documenting shutter and viewfinder
  • Capturing light seal condition
  • Photographing black cameras clearly

Best photo styles for vintage cameras for selling

Photography tips for vintage cameras for selling

  • 1.Show lens elements for fungus or haze
  • 2.Document shutter and film door
  • 3.Include light seal condition
  • 4.Show all dials and controls
